Michele's Story

"I don't have good hair."

I have curly, frizzy hair, and I am very fussy about it. When people with curly, frizzy hair get it blow dried straight, they get very obsessed about the way it looks, and it never looks right. People with straight hair just don't comprehend it because they just get out of the shower and their hair is straight. Curly hair is much harder to deal with, so I started wearing wigs.

"Wigs are great for emergencies."

I use wigs when I have a bad hair day and I don't want to wash my hair, or if I am going to a business meeting and I want to look appropriate and my hair is sticking like glue to my head because I didn't have time to fix it. A wig is just a time saver.

I have one wig that is like my own hair that I use when I can't get to my hair dresser for important events. When he isn't available, the wig is. I would much rather have my real hair fresh, of course, but what is great about the wigs is that they are for bad hair days. I wear this wig when I just want to get away with being me.

"People care about their hair, whether they have some and how it looks on their head."

Hair is a big deal to me. I have thinning hair because I am older and closer to menopausal age, so the wigs help me with that. You can also try out a new haircut without cutting your hair, which is a very good thing because if you cut your hair and you hate it, it can't grow back in five seconds. They are also just about having fun and experimenting. I've been out with friends standing right next to them while they're saying, "Where is Michele?" and they don't recognize me. It is fun to be a different person for a little while.
